    Preparing the walleye for air frying

    Before cooking, make sure to remove any bones and pat the walleye dry with paper towels to absorb any excess moisture. Next, season the fish to your liking. You can use a simple mixture of salt, pepper, and paprika, or experiment with other seasonings like lemon pepper or garlic powder. Make sure to coat both sides of the walleye evenly.

    Additionally, it is recommended to let the seasoned walleye sit in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es before air frying. This allows the flavors to fully penetrate the fish and results in a more flavorful dish. If you're short on time, you can skip this step, but keep in mind that the taste may not be as pronounced.

    The best temperature and time settings for cooking walleye in an air fryer

    The optimal temperature for cooking walleye in an air fryer is between 375-400°F. Depending on the thickness of the fish, it should take around 8-12 minutes to cook. To ensure even cooking, flip the walleye halfway through the cooking time. Don't overcrowd the air fryer basket, as this will affect the cooking time and result in uneven cooking.

    When preparing the walleye for cooking, it's important to pat it dry with paper towels to remove any excess moisture. This will help the fish to cook evenly and prevent it from becoming soggy. Additionally, you can season the walleye with your favorite herbs and spices to add extra flavor.

    If you're cooking multiple pieces of walleye in the air fryer, it's best to cook them in batches rather than all at once. This will ensure that each piece of fish has enough space to cook properly and will result in a more consistent texture and flavor. Once the walleye is cooked, serve it immediately with a side of lemon wedges and tartar sauce for a delicious and satisfying meal.

    Tips for achieving crispy, golden brown walleye in an air fryer

    To achieve a crispy, golden brown exterior on your walleye, make sure to lightly coat it with cooking spray before air frying. This will help the coating crisp up without adding additional oil. Avoid opening the air fryer basket too often, as this will release the heat and affect the cooking time. You can also try shaking the basket a few times during cooking to help the walleye cook evenly.

    Another tip for achieving crispy walleye in an air fryer is to preheat the air fryer before adding the fish. This will ensure that the walleye starts cooking immediately and will help to prevent it from becoming soggy. Additionally, you can try using panko breadcrumbs instead of regular breadcrumbs for a crunchier texture.

    It's important to note that the cooking time may vary depending on the thickness of the walleye fillets. Thicker fillets may require a longer cooking time, while thinner fillets may cook faster. To ensure that the walleye is fully cooked, use a meat thermometer to check that the internal temperature has reached 145°F.

    How Long to Cook Walleye in Air Fryer

    To cook walleye in an air fryer, preheat the air fryer to 400 degrees Fahrenheit. Place the walleye fillets in the air fryer basket, leaving a little space between them so that the air can circulate freely. Air fry the walleye for 10-12 minutes, or until it is cooked through and flakes easily with a fork.

    If you are using frozen walleye fillets, increase the cooking time to 12-15 minutes.

    Frequently asked questions about cooking walleye in an air fryer

    Q: Can I use frozen walleye in an air fryer?

    A: Yes, you can air fry frozen walleye, but make sure to adjust the cooking time and temperature accordingly. It may take longer to cook, and you may need to increase the temperature slightly.

    Q: Do I need to preheat my air fryer before cooking walleye?

    A: It's recommended to preheat your air fryer for a few minutes before cooking, as this will help ensure even cooking and a crispy texture.

    Q: Can I cook other types of fish in an air fryer?

    A: Absolutely! Air fryers are an excellent way to prepare a variety of fish, including salmon, trout, and tilapia. Use the same seasoning and time and temperature guidelines as you would for walleye.

    Air frying tips and tricks from professional chefs to enhance your cooking skills

    Professional chefs recommend using a thermometer to ensure that the walleye is cooked to the correct internal temperature of 145°F. They also suggest using a non-stick spray or parchment paper to prevent the fish from sticking to the air fryer basket. Finally, they advise experimenting with different cooking times and temperatures to find the perfect settings for your air fryer and your personal taste preferences.
